CHER, 74 YEARS OLD

With a successful career spanning over six decades, the Goddes of Pop not only dominated the music industry, but she also has a couple of Academy Awards and Golden Globe wins under her belt. She first became popular in 1965 with her hit, ‘I Got You Babe’ with Sonny Bono. She went on to hit superstar levels with her solo career later on. In the late 1970s, she was raking in as much as $300,000 a week for her concert residency in Las Vegas. In addition, she played in critically acclaimed movies like Silkwood, Mask, and Moonstruck, proving that there was nothing she couldn’t do. Today, she still goes on tours and takes acting roles every now and again.

ROBERT REDFORD, 84 YEARS OLD

Robert Redford debuted in the early 1960s, but it wasn’t until 1969 that the world truly fell in love with his charming smile and rugged good looks. He played in movies like Butch Cassidy, the Sundance Kid, and All the President’s Men. Throughout his successful 60-year career, he’s won plenty of awards including an Academy Award for Lifetime Achievement in 2002. Not to mention, he’s an Oscar-winning director as well as the founder of the Sundance Film Festival. In 2018, he starred in The Old Man & the Gun.
